#da6913 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#da6913 is composed of 85.5% red, 41.2%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.8%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 25.9 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 46.5%. #da6913 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d226 with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#da6913 color description : Vivid orange.

#da6913 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#da6913 has RGB values of R:218, G:105,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.91,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14313747.

Shades and Tints of #da6913

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fef5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#da6913

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f756e is the less saturated color, while #ec6701 is the most saturated one.
